Saffron Trade and Export: Understanding the Business of the World's Most Prized Spice.

Saffron is one of India's most prized spices and a major export. The saffron produced in Kashmir is of the highest quality and is renowned for its bright red color and distinctive taste. The main saffron-producing states in India include Kashmir, Rajasthan, Himachal Pradesh, and Uttar Pradesh.

02. Economic Impact:

Saffron also plays a major role in India's economy. It is a major source of income for many rural farmers and provides employment opportunities in rural areas. It also helps boost tourism in India, as many tourists visit India to purchase saffron. India is also a major exporter of saffron to other countries, which helps to generate foreign exchange for the country.
